Shellcode Injection Github

Shellcode can be stored as resource and retrieved at runtime with FindResource API. This isn’t always possible (or smart), so powersploit is also already available in Kali under /usr/share/powersploit. exe: PE32 executable (GUI) Intel 80386, for MS Windows Comments. If you don’t want to write your toolings/implant in C, you can also get your hands dirty with NimlineWhispers, which builds the ASM-file and the header file for Nim-Code. Making shellcode great again. 6 Type "help" (without quotes) inside the emulator prompt to get a list of all the available options. It’s a popular penetration testing tool, also included in the Empire post-exploitation agent. Shellcode injection consists of the following main parts: The shellcode that is to be injected is crafted. github 2020-06-06 19:18. A shellcode is a small piece of code used as the payload in the exploitation of a software vulnerability. This video demonstrates a basic shellcode injection into a legitimate application, without taking advantage of the advanced features of Shellter. 1 Level 1 For Phase 1, you will not inject new code. In hacking, a shellcode is a small piece of code used as the payload in the exploitation of a software vulnerability. How is Windows Local Shellcode Injection abbreviated? WLSI is defined as Windows Local Shellcode Injection somewhat frequently. Controller. Open Closed Paid Out. Vanila Process Injection; DLL Injection; Vanila Process Injection Currently the program accepts shellcode in 3 formats. 32-bit Windows A1 - Injection AI Arduinio Assembly BadUSB BOF Buffer Overflow Burpsuite bWAPP bypass Cheat Engine Computer Networking Controls Convert coverter Crack csharp CTF Deque Docker Download exploit Exploit-Exercises Exploit Development Facebook game. The shellcode is expected to be in Base64 format. With a size limit that large, we can easily smuggle shellcode into our ICMP request and then inject it into a process on the listener’s end. מבדקי חדירה - האקינג - סייבר התקפי. OpenProcess(process_all, False, process_id) – This line makes a call to OpenProcess. Shellcode is widely used in code injection attacks, and writing shellcode is challenging. Hey guys check out my latest article https://0xrick. Fixing the shellcode: Actually we need to modify the generated shellcode little bit to get things work smoothly. Instead, your exploit string will redirect the program to execute an existing procedure. Facebook group. Find the best shell-storm. Get a remote shell by Shellcode injection with buffer overflow The ctf. MEAN Stack Cheat Sheet Github Repository Those who want to become a Full Stack Developer t Tagged with node, javascript, angular, tutorial. The victim machine also needs to download the Invoke-Shellcode. Tag: shellcode injection. POCs for Shellcode Injection via Callbacks. It is NOT malware (just executes calc. This is what is known as an egg hunter. Modern Windows version have put in place some mitigation that prevent the shellcode to. 16 - XML Parsing Stack-based Buffer Overflow. Process Environment Block (PEB) is a user-mode data structure that can be used by applications (and by extend by malware) to get information such as the list of loaded modules, process startup arguments, heap address among other useful capabilities. The unmodified shellcode should not be detectable by popular antivirus. You can turn ASLR on and try to execute our earlier exploit. shellcode = shellcode. It is NOT malware (just executes calc. For example, shellcode attacks are often used to create buffer-overflows on. C_Shot is an offensive security tool written in C which is designed to download a remote shellcode binary file (. Linux/x86 Bindshell Shellcode65 bytes small Linux/x86 bindshell shellcode that binds /bin/sh to TCP/0. By default on a Windows Server Product Windows Remote Management (WinRM) is enabled, but Remote Desktop (RDP) is Disabled. Jan 21, 2019. March 8, 2021: Learned new LFI techiniques, log poisoning from the archangel room. Open Closed Paid Out. Find the best shell-storm. GitHub Gist: instantly share code, notes, and snippets. Telegram group. It's just another way to inject code. 25 - Poll Vote Count SQL Injection. goodinfohome. SyncBreeze 10. 1 – Inicie noip 2 – Inicie Postgresql 3 – Check seu Ip em: 4 – Inicie Msfconsole com suas configuraçoes: Ex: msfconsole -x “use exploit/multi/handler;set. (people only really care about the arbitrary shellcode injection. PE Injection、DLL Injection、Process Injection、Thread Injection、Code Injection、Shellcode Injection、ELF Injection、Dylib Injection, including 400+Tools and 350+posts. The program is designed to perform process injection. Twitter X-code. GitHub is where people build software. 0, released on December 5th, 2019. 16 - XML Parsing Stack-based Buffer Overflow. SHELLCODE INJECTION. 1 "Apple Fritter" - Dual-Mode Shellcode, AMSI, and More TLDR: Version v0. exe: PE32 executable (GUI) Intel 80386, for MS Windows Comments. GitHub – bhassani/EternalBlueC: EternalBlue suite remade in C/C++ which includes: MS17-010 Exploit, EternalBlue vulnerability detector, DoublePulsar detector and DoublePulsar Shellcode & DLL uploader. This also makes shellcode difficult to improve, and eventually, all the AV classifiers have the word “EVIL” written all over the place. Bypassing Outbound Detection • DLL/PE Injection to iexplore. It will corrupt the executable as we will overwrite the orginal code to execute the shellcode. ¶Compiling. See full list on fireeye. It was an easy privesc, I was able to identify a pathvar manipulation vuln. Ghost in the Shellcode Teaser – Poetry Writeup January 12, 2013 May 22, 2013 Christopher Truncer CTF , Featured Category Our team was presented with the following text for the Poetry challenge:. You can always come back for Windows Cmd Shellcode because we update all the latest coupons and special deals weekly. Shellcode injection consists of the following main parts: The shellcode that is to be injected is crafted. Buffer Overflow Vulnerability Lab. Finding a possible place to inject shellcode. 4 RTARGET 2 ROP touch2 35 5 RTARGET 3 ROP touch3 5 CI: Code injection ROP: Return-oriented programming Figure 1: Summary of attack lab phases 4. Find the best shell-storm. Here is the code for Win32Injector:. In this POC we have been able to perform this using these functions: VirtualAlloc: To allocate memory in order to fill it directly with the downloaded shellcode. 1 – Inicie noip 2 – Inicie Postgresql 3 – Check seu Ip em: 4 – Inicie Msfconsole com suas configuraçoes: Ex: msfconsole -x “use exploit/multi/handler;set. A shellcode injection is an attack which exploits software vulnerabilities to give attackers control of a compromised machine. This tool has been written to support the new features added to the process injection tool that I wrote for learning about various Process Injection techniques and to enhance my knowledge about C# and Windows API. It is a truly dynamic shellcode injector. It was an easy privesc, I was able to identify a pathvar manipulation vuln. CVE-2017-15950. Since our shellcode will copy the NT AUTHORITY\SYSTEM token to a cmd. Add the corresponding option in the "options" class. An encoded shellcode is a shellcode that have the payload encoded in order to escape the signature based detection. Under the hood, what donut does is “unpacking” the PE that was provided as input and executes it in-memory. Over the years, the security community as a whole realized that there needed to be a way to stop exploit developers from easily executing malicious shellcode. 25 - Poll Vote Count SQL Injection. Hey guys , In the last post about buffer overflow we exploited a buffer overflow vulnerability where we were able to inject a shellcode and escalate privileges to root. Basic ShellCode Injection. so (into the function time ), which I think succeeds - before this I tried some simpler shellcode that worked perfectly. undetectable payload github 2020, Jan 30, 2020 · Undetectable payload for Windows 10 - Unicorn tool payload modification In this post, I will explain you how to hack Window 10 with publicly available tool, by using PowerShell downgrade attack and inject shellcode straight into memory. Builds of scdbg exist for both Windows and Unix users. Here is the code for Win32Injector:. I am trying to inject this shellcode into libc. This will save the shellcode as a C array to loader_exe. I played a bit with the awesome Donut project, ending up writing a module for executing arbitrary shellcode within Meterpreter aka executing Mimikatz in-memory, reflectively and interactively! 🐱‍👤. More specifically: It uses AES encryption in order to encrypt a given shellcode; Generates an executable file which contains the encrypted payload. Fixing the shellcode: Actually we need to modify the generated shellcode little bit to get things work smoothly. One of the articles titled In-Memory PE EXE Execution by Z0MBiE demonstrated how to manually load and run a Portable Executable entirely from memory. Currently the tool supports 4 process injection techniques. This tool has been written to support the new features added to the process injection tool that I wrote for learning about various Process Injection techniques and to enhance my knowledge about C# and Windows API. — 15 "PyInjector Shellcode Injection". com/r00t-3xp10it/venom. submitted 5 months ago by BananaAware. webapps exploit for Windows platform. GitHub is where people build software. Pe injection dll injection process injection thread injection code injection shellcode injection elf 5000 pts orange tsai sql injection in github enterprise. Jan 21, 2019. I don't think I'm infected as such, but can't find anything relating to this on the web - can anyone tell me what happened here or advise on what to do?. Shellcode is widely used in code injection attacks, and writing shellcode is challenging. description = "No obfuscation, basic injection of shellcode through virtualalloc or void pointer. A community for technical news and discussion of information security and closely related topics. Shellcode() #. ### Then follow the same rule to compose the injection w. Shellcode Injection This is performed by stagers (usually) Their goal typically is to download and inject a reflective dll Any language that has access to the Windows API can have their own shellcode injection functionality While this sounds complicated, it’s an easy step You only need to call four functions. This isn’t always possible (or smart), so powersploit is also already available in Kali under /usr/share/powersploit. com Blogger 4348 1001 1500 tag:blogger. If you have adjusted/modified the default anti-exploit settings for web browsers in Malwarebytes, then there is a chance an issue may occur. Dynamic shellcode injection mean that the start of the Venom #Linux #ShellCode venom - shellcode generator/compiler/handler (metasploit) github. Msfvenom windows payloads and custom shellcode supported. Do check out my Github page if you are interested to find out more. Add the corresponding option in the "options" class. Generally, shellcode injection and execution follow these steps: Obtain a handle to a process (local or remote) Allocate new region of memory to the process; Write/Move/Map shellcode to the newly allocated memory region; Execute the shellcode from the memory region using various methods. Cross-process injection gives attackers the ability to run malicious code that masquerades as legitimate programs. It is a truly dynamic shellcode injector. https Obfuscated shellcode might help operator's to evade static detection while trying to inject the shellcode into remote process. Windows Shellcode Injection Process inject NoDirectCall LL/GPA: Inject and Execute shellcode into remote process memory (default: OneDrive. Linux Shellcode 101: From Hell to Shell 14 minute read Understand Shellcode on Linux 32bit and 64bit.